In January 2024, a team led by French archaeologist Stéphen Rostain published a landmark paper in Science: “Two thousand years of garden urbanism in the Upper Amazon” (DOI: 10.1126/science.adi6317). Using airborne lidar to strip away the jungle canopy, they mapped a network of 15 urban centres in Ecuador’s Upano Valley, with more than 6,000 earthen platforms, plazas and straight engineered roads, dating back to around 500 BC. It is the oldest and largest urban network ever found in Amazonia.

What strikes me is what this confirms. The Spanish chroniclers of the 1540s, men like Orellana and Carvajal, described thriving cities along the Amazon and were dismissed as liars for four centuries. The cities were there all along, the forest just swallowed them after contact.
